It’s our Patient Advisor’s role to make our patients feel like a superstar from the moment they enter our clinics. Our Patient Advisors are often the first person our patient interacts with. Every day will bring something new, but your day to day role will involve:
- Building relationships with patients and ensuring regular communication prior to and following their treatment
- Assisting in patient consultations
- Scanning patients eyes using state of the art equipment as part of a full health check
- Assisting patients to complete health questionnaires
- Introducing patients to their optometrist
- Scheduling treatment dates
- Discussing finance options
- Accurately maintaining patient records
